American Resources Secures $5M Credit Line to Expand Critical Mineral Feedstock Supply

American Resources Corp. secured a $5 million inventory line of credit with Old National Bank to finance the acquisition of end-of-life materials for processing into high-value mineral feedstocks. The credit facility will support the expansion of material into ReElement Technologies' refining platform, enabling the company to build a resilient, U.S.-based supply chain for rare earths and other strategic materials. The agreement aligns with American Resources' strategy to respond to growing domestic demand for critical minerals used in clean energy, defense, and advanced manufacturing.
